jim says that the output of the floor function is the number before the decimal point in the input. For what domain is Jim’s sta
Mila [183]

Jim’s statement is correct for all numbers greater than or equal to 0. It does not work for negative numbers. For example, the floor of –3.5 is –4, where –4 is not equal to –3, the number before the decimal point. Hope this helps!
